Discover the Historic Shubert Theatre
The Shubert Theatre is more than a theater — it's a historic cultural anchor that has hosted numerous pre-Broadway tryouts and world premieres. Set in the heart of downtown New Haven, this beloved venue blends classic grandeur with an intimate, audience-first atmosphere — and yes, many fans start with the Shubert Theater - CT seating chart to lock in the perfect view.
Inside, you’ll find a timeless design that reflects its early 20th-century origins. With an elegant proscenium arch and ornate interior details, the theater pairs charm with comfort across its 1,600-seat configuration.
The Shubert Theatre presents a wide range of programming — from Broadway shows and concerts to dance, comedy, and community events. Operated as a non-profit organization, it has played a significant role in New Haven’s cultural history, regularly welcoming pre-Broadway tryouts and world premieres that add to its legacy.
Distinctive inside and out, the venue’s classic façade is especially striking when illuminated at night. Its refined interior — complete with the kind of craftsmanship that defines great American theaters — makes every performance feel special.

Seating Recommendations and Charts
Shubert Theatre offers seating for approximately 1,600 guests, arranged in a classic reserved-seating layout across the Orchestra, Mezzanine, and Balcony. Use the Shubert Theater - CT seating chart to compare views by level and zero in on the right price point for your night out.
- Orchestra: Ideal if you prefer to be close to the stage, the Orchestra provides immersive sightlines and a strong connection to the performers.
- Mezzanine: A great balance of perspective and value — a slightly elevated view that still feels intimate and centered.
- Balcony: Perfect for a wide-angle look at the full stage, the Balcony is a smart choice for value seekers and groups.

Food and Restaurants Near Shubert Theatre
If you're arriving early or staying nearby, there are excellent dining options in downtown New Haven:
- Louis' Lunch (Downtown) — Historic spot known as the birthplace of the hamburger, serving classic burgers in a cozy setting.
- BAR (Downtown) — Popular for its brick oven pizzas, craft beer, and lively atmosphere.
- Frank Pepe Pizzeria Napoletana (Downtown) — Iconic New Haven pizzeria famous for its coal-fired, thin-crust pies.
- Union League Cafe (Downtown) — Upscale French restaurant offering elegant dining in a historic building.
- Claire's Corner Copia (Downtown) — Vegetarian eatery known for organic, globally inspired dishes and baked goods.
- Caseus Fromagerie Bistro (Downtown) — Cheese-centric bistro specializing in gourmet comfort food and artisanal cheeses.
- Zinc (Downtown) — Modern American cuisine with a focus on locally sourced ingredients.
- The Owl Shop (Downtown) — Classic cigar lounge and bar with a menu of small plates and cocktails.
